简介
instance-js 是一个实用的 JavaScript 库,在前端开发中非常有用。它提供了一种轻量级的方法,方便创建和切换不同的实例。如果你正在寻找一种灵活的方式来处理多个组件或对象实例,instance-js 很可能是你的最佳选择。
安装
如果你想使用 instance-js,建议通过 npm 进行安装。这是一个基于现代项目结构的包,因此所有的依赖都会自动被安装。在你的项目中,你可以使用以下命令进行安装:
--- ------- ----------- ------
如果你想手动安装它,你可以通过以下方式进行下载:
- 前往 https://github.com/nathanaelcherrier/instance-js/releases 下载最新的发布版本。
- 复制 instance.min.js 或 instance.js 文件,并将其添加到你的项目中。
使用
要使用 instance-js,你需要首先创建一个实例。你可以使用以下代码来创建一个实例:
------ -------- ---- -------------- ----- ---------- - --- -----------
这样就创建了一个新的实例,它基于默认配置并准备好使用。如果你想传递其他参数或选项,可以像下面这样的方式创建实例:
----- ---------- - --- ---------- -- -- -- ---
创建新实例
要创建新实例,你需要使用 create() 方法。你可以这样来创建一个新的实例:
----- ------------- - --------------------
这个方法会返回一个新的实例对象,它是通过原型继承从 myInstance 实例对象中创建的,因此会继承与其相关的所有属性和方法。这个新的实例对象可以像原始实例对象一样使用,并且可以独立地管理自己的状态和配置。
销毁实例
如果你不再需要一个实例,你可以在任何时候销毁它。你可以使用 destroy() 方法来销毁实例。这个方法会将实例从内存中删除,并释放所有相关的资源。你可以像下面这样来销毁实例:
---------------------
切换实例
当你创建了多个实例时,你可能需要在这些实例之间切换。你可以使用 setActive() 方法来切换实例。这个方法会将指定的实例设置为当前实例,并且将原来的实例设置为非活动状态。你可以这样来设置活动实例:
-----------------------
示例代码
下面的示例代码展示了如何使用 instance-js 来管理多个实例:
------ -------- ---- -------------- ----- ---------- - --- ----------- ----- --------------- - -------------------- ----- ---------------- - -------------------- ----- --------------- - -------------------- ----------------------- -- -------- ---------- ---------------------------- -- -------- --------------- ----------------------------- -- -------- ---------------- -------------------------- -- -- --------------- --
这个示例代码创建了一个新的 Instance 对象,然后从该对象中创建了 3 个新实例。它还演示了如何使用 setActive() 和 destroy() 方法来切换和删除实例。
总结
instance-js 是一个优秀的 JavaScript 库,它提供了一种灵活的方法来处理多个组件或对象实例。如果你正在寻找一个强大的工具,可以帮助你更好地管理你的代码,并更容易地维护你的应用程序,请考虑使用 instance-js。
来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/6005602b81e8991b448de5b5